Court Strikes Out Charges Against Pastor Accused Of Defiling Daughter

Justice Abiola Soladoye of the Lagos State Sexual Offences and Domestic Violence Court on Wednesday discharged a Pastor of the Redeemed Christian Church of God (RCCG), Emmanuel Orekoya, who was arraigned for allegedly defiling his 17-year-old daughter.
Justice Soladoye struck out the two-count charge of defilement and sexual assault by penetration brought against Orekoya by the state government for lack of diligent prosecution.
In her ruling during Wednesday’s proceedings, the judge held that the prosecution failed to present witnesses to prove the charge against the defendant.
She also held, “The prosecution’s case is a colossal waste of time as there is no single witness in court to testify against the pastor after 10 adjournments.
“This case is struck out for want of diligent prosecution.
“After the defendant’s arraignment on February 26, 2024, to date, making a total of 10 adjournments, no witness has ever come up before this court to testify.
“It is right that justice delayed is justice denied.
“Prosecution is at liberty to re-arrest the defendant and bring him to justice whenever they have assembled their witnesses to prosecute this case,” the judge stated.
The prosecution had accused the defendant of defiling his daughter sometimes in 2017 on Jacob Adeleye Street, Odoeran in Itire, Surulere in Lagos, by inserting his penis into her mouth contrary to Sections 137 and 162 of the Criminal Laws of Lagos State (2015).
The pastor had, however, pleaded not guilty to the charge.
